Parag Foundation has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ses: CoursesEligibilityMBA/PGDMCandidate must be a graduate from a recognized college /university.B.E. / B.TechCandidate must have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ognized school/board.After 10th DiplomaCandidate must have passed 10 class from any recognised Board/Council.

Parag Foundation offers Degree and Diploma courses including 2 UG and 3 PG courses. These programs are offerred in Part Time mode. Seats intake availability for these courses at Parag Foundation goes up to 45.

You can't get admission in MBA without graduation. The eligibility criteria for any MBA institute is, at minimum, graduation of 3 or 4 years from a recognized university with minimum 50% in graduation. So, do your graduation first, then go for MBA.
